Understanding the Mechanics of Crash Games
The fundamental principle behind crash games revolves around a provably fair system. This means that the outcome of each round is determined by cryptographic algorithms, ensuring transparency and eliminating any possibility of manipulation by the platform. Players can typically verify the fairness of each game themselves, providing a level of trust often lacking in traditional online gambling. At
Beyond the provably fair aspect, understanding the statistical probabilities at play is crucial. While each round is independent, over a large number of games, a certain distribution of crash multipliers can be expected. However, it's important to remember that past results do not influence future outcomes. Successfully navigating the game requires understanding that there’s an element of inherent randomness. The volatility inherent in crash games is a significant factor. High volatility means wider swings in potential outcomes – larger wins, but also more frequent losses. The Role of Random Number Generators (RNGs)
At the core of any online casino game, especially those relying on chance like crash games sits the Random Number Generator. This is a sophisticated algorithm which produces a sequence of numbers that appear random. However, they are, in fact, deterministic, meaning the sequence is entirely predictable if you know the initial seed. In a provably fair system, like that used by
The RNG used must be cryptographically secure, meaning it is resistant to prediction and manipulation even with advanced computing power. This ensures that each game round is truly random and independent of previous results. Players can typically access information about the seeds used in each round through the game interface, allowing them to verify the fairness of the outcome themselves. Developing a Winning Strategy
While there's no foolproof strategy to guarantee success in crash games, certain approaches can significantly improve your odds. One popular method is the Martingale system, where you double your bet after each loss, aiming to recover your previous losses with a single win. However, this strategy can quickly deplete your bankroll, particularly during extended losing streaks. Another approach involves setting a target multiplier and automatically cashing out when that multiplier is reached. This requires discipline and the ability to resist the temptation to chase higher payouts.
Effective bankroll management is arguably the most important aspect of any crash game strategy. You should never bet more than a small percentage of your total bankroll on a single round, typically between 1% and 5%. This helps to mitigate the risk of significant losses and allows you to weather losing streaks. It's also crucial to set realistic goals and walk away when you reach them, or when you hit a predetermined loss limit. Emotional control is paramount. Panic betting or chasing losses can lead to impulsive decisions and ultimately result in larger losses. Maintaining a level head and sticking to your strategy are crucial for long-term success.

The Importance of Responsible Gaming
The thrill of crash games can be addictive, and it's essential to practice responsible gaming habits. This includes setting limits on your time and money spent gambling, recognizing the signs of problem gambling, and seeking help if needed.
It’s crucial to remember that gambling should be viewed as a form of entertainment, not a source of income. Never gamble with money you can’t afford to lose, and avoid chasing losses in an attempt to recoup your funds. If you find yourself spending increasing amounts of time and money on gambling, experiencing negative emotions related to gambling, or neglecting other important aspects of your life, it may be time to seek help. Resources are available, and reaching out is a sign of strength, not weakness.
